Nintendo Switch 2 is out here playing tech Tetris with its 256GB internal storage that’s about as spacious as a shoebox for a digital game library. Fear not, early adopters! Samsung’s 512GB P9 microSD Express card is discount-dancing at $94.99 on Amazon if you can hunt down that on-page coupon, which ironically costs less than the $99.99 original price. If you think $54.99 for the 256GB model is cheap, Walmart's Onn card tried undercutting at $85 but vanished faster than your willpower near a midnight sale. And yes, 512GB can fit a dozen mini games or the colossal 93GB Final Fantasy VII Remake Intergrade—because who needs physical space when you have digital guilt? Also heads up: game-key cards make digital bloat mandatory, so you’re basically gambling on storage like a tech hoarder with commitment issues.
